Highlights
Are people in Lake Mills older or younger than people in DeForest?
- The Median Age in Lake Mills is 1.0 years older than in DeForest.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lake Mills or DeForest?
- Lake Mills housing costs are 22.3% more expensive than DeForest hous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lake Mills or DeForest?
- The average commute for residents of Lake Mills is 1.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of DeForest.
